Whispers of the Dragon Egg: The Unseen Path
In the heart of the ancient Douluo Empire, beneath the shadow of towering mountains and the whispering winds of destiny, there lay the fabled Dragon Egg. It was said that the one who found it would wield the power of the dragon, shaping the fate of the world. Among the countless Douluo who had set forth on this quest, none had returned with the Egg. Until now.
Douluo Wei, known for his unparalleled martial prowess and his unwavering spirit, embarked on the quest. He was not just a Douluo; he was the son of a legendary Douluo who had failed to retrieve the Egg. The weight of his father's legacy rested heavily upon his shoulders, and he carried it with a resolve that matched the strength of the dragon itself.
As Wei ventured deeper into the treacherous mountains, the path before him was shrouded in mystery. He encountered other Douluo, each with their own reason for seeking the Egg, and they formed an unlikely alliance. Among them was a young woman named Ling, whose eyes held the wisdom of ages, and a rogue Douluo named Hong, whose past was as enigmatic as his skills in combat.
The journey was fraught with danger, and Wei soon discovered that the Egg was not the only prize at stake. The Egg was a beacon, drawing forth those who sought to wield its power for their own gain, and the Douluo were not the only ones vying for it. Ancient beasts, vengeful spirits, and the remnants of a forgotten civilization lay in wait, testing the resolve of the questers.
As they delved deeper into the mountains, the path that had been so clear at the beginning became obscured. Wei, Ling, and Hong stumbled upon a hidden chamber, its walls adorned with cryptic symbols and enigmatic runes. It was here that they found the true secret of the Dragon Egg: it was not just a source of power, but a path to enlightenment, one that could only be traversed by those who were truly ready.
The path, however, was not for the faint-hearted. It required a sacrifice, a choice that would test the very essence of their souls. Wei found himself at a crossroads, torn between his quest for power and his duty to his friends and allies. The decision he made would determine not only his fate but the fate of all those who had joined him on this perilous journey.
As the trio stood at the threshold of the path, the air grew thick with tension. The symbols glowed faintly, casting an eerie light over their faces. Wei looked to Ling, who met his gaze with a calm that belied the gravity of the situation. Hong, ever the rogue, smirked, as if he had anticipated this moment all along.
"Which path will you choose?" Ling asked, her voice steady.
"The path of the Douluo," Wei replied without hesitation. "The path that leads us to the Egg, not just for power, but for the greater good."
With a nod of agreement from Ling and a knowing look from Hong, they stepped forward, their resolve unshaken. The symbols on the wall seemed to come alive, and the ground beneath them trembled as the path opened before them.
The path was not just a physical journey; it was a journey into the heart and soul of each Douluo. They faced trials that tested their martial prowess, their moral compass, and their very essence as Douluo. Wei, with his unwavering spirit, led them through each challenge, his actions inspiring those around him.
As they reached the end of the path, they were met with a sight that defied all expectations. The Dragon Egg was not a single object, but a series of eggs, each containing a fragment of the dragon's essence. The true power of the Egg lay not in its size or its luster, but in the knowledge and understanding it imparted to those who were worthy.
Wei, Ling, and Hong stood before the eggs, their hearts heavy with the weight of their decisions. They had come so far, and now the true test began. Each Douluo had to choose one egg, and the path they took from there would determine their future.
Wei reached out, his fingers trembling as he chose the smallest egg, the one that seemed to resonate with his soul. As he held it, a surge of energy coursed through him, and he felt a connection to the dragon that was both terrifying and exhilarating.
Ling and Hong made their choices as well, and as they did, the path before them split into three distinct routes. Each route represented a different aspect of the dragon's essence: strength, wisdom, and agility.
The trio set off on their separate paths, their hearts filled with a mix of fear and excitement. They knew that their journey was far from over, but they also knew that they had taken a step towards understanding the true nature of the Dragon Egg and the power it held.
The Dragon Egg had not only provided them with a source of immense power but also a path to enlightenment. It was a path that would change them forever, and one that they had chosen to walk together, bound by the bonds of friendship and the quest for the ultimate truth.
As they ventured into the unknown, the mountains echoed with the whispers of the dragon, guiding them along the path they had chosen. And so, the Douluo's quest for the Dragon Egg continued, not just for power, but for the knowledge that would shape their destinies and the fate of the world.
